Kwara engages additional 2000 youths
As part of its celebration of the first anniversary of the Kwara State Bridge Empowerment Scheme and to ease unemployment challenges in the state, the state government is poised to up scale the scheme with an additional 2,000 jobs.
The state Governor, Alhaji Abdulfatah Ahmed, gave this indication in Ilorin, the state capital, on Monday, when the Emir of Ilorin, Alhaji Ibrahim Sulu-Gambari, paid him the traditional Sallah homage at the Government House.
According to Ahmed, the state government is also partnering with the Federal Government for the provision of additional 10,000 jobs for youths in the state in consonant with its youth empowerment programme.
Ahmed said his administration has also energized entrepreneurship in the state with the disbursement of N500 million micro credit intervention scheme to over 300 small business entrepreneurs.
He added that "another set of entrepreneurs will be empowered and thousand of youth jobs created when the second tranch of the micro credit fund is disbursed to qualifying small business owners before the end of the year."
On health care, Ahmed said when the ongoing comprehensive rehabilitation work in Ilorin, Omu-Aran, Offa, Share and Kaiama General Hospitals are completed, another five would be overhauled next year under his administration's access to health care within 500 metres policy.
The governor said the state government remained committed to the provision of additional primary health care centres in every ward in the state to boost healthcare delivery.
Ahmed explained that his administration's policies in all sectors were borne out of the significance of the linkage among people's wellbeing, peace and development that are karnel to its shared prosperity programme.
Sulu-Gambari, in his remarks, advocated the institutionalization of constitutionalism in Nigeria for life to be more meaningful for Nigerians.
Sulu-Gambari, who noted that if democracy does not work in Nigeria, a country with huge potentials, it cannot work elsewhere in Africa, solicited the cooperation of Nigerians and the international community for the entrenchment of democracy in the country.
Sulu-Gambari, who is the Chairman, Kwara State Traditional Council, pledged the cooperation of the traditional institution and Kwarans in general to the Abdulfatah Ahmed administration.
